How many green card applications TWIN PEAK INTERNATIONAL INC has filed each quarter, from FY2018 to today.
What this means
TWIN PEAK INTERNATIONAL INC applied to sponsor 12 workers for green cards between 2018 and 2025. A green card application is what an employer files to help a worker stay in the U.S. permanently.
